VDOT is seeking an experienced Senior Network Engineer (Sr NE) to implement and provide support to the agency’s IT Network infrastructure. The Sr NE performs day-to-day activities related to the support, documentation, research, analysis, and implementation of VDOT Network related infrastructure.

Candidates must have in-depth, considerable knowledge and hands-on experience understanding, documenting, and maintaining Network related infrastructure.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Considerable knowledge and working experience with enterprise routers, switches, VPN concentrators, firewalls, wireless access points, and load balancers (including the ability to document, set up, configure, upgrade, manage, and troubleshooting)
  • Be capable of troubleshooting Network related infrastructure.
  • Identifies and diagnoses system problems by using line monitors, diagnostic software, test equipment.
  • Works closely with agency’s IT infrastructure suppliers and stakeholders to gather requirements, specifications, and configurations to assure they are accurate and up to date.
  • Responsible for assisting in troubleshooting and resolving network issues impacting application performance and uptime.
  • Assist in overseeing the installation, documentation, and upgrades of various agency facility data network infrastructure.
  • Will oversee and collaborate with cloud and DevSecOps teams to optimize hybrid connectivity and SDWAN configurations.
  • Must have the ability to provide documentation, network architecture topology diagrams, IP schemes, firewall rules, and access controls when required.
  • Must have the ability to work independently on assigned projects. 
  • Must have minimally obtained an industry standard networking certification (example: Cisco CCNA, Juniper JNCIA- Junos, etc.)

Required skills and experience

  • Considerable knowledge and hands-on working experience with enterprise routers, switches, VPN concentrators, firewalls, wireless access points, and load balancers (including the ability to setup, configure, upgrade, manage, and troubleshoot)
  • Demonstrated and hands-on ability to design, install and troubleshoot local-area and wide-area enterprise networks.
  • Considerable direct hands-on experience, engineering and design experience in networking industry required.
  • Industry standard networking certification (example: Cisco CCNA, Juniper JNCIA- Junos, etc.)
  • In-depth experience designing installing and troubleshooting local-area and wide-area enterprise networks.
  • Experience monitoring IT environments for compliance with information security, architecture policies, and standards.
  • Experience creating repeatable, reliable, scalable network architectures with fault tolerance.
  • Experience performance tuning, monitoring systems, statistics/metrics collection, and disaster recovery.
  • Experience creating network diagrams using industry standard tools such as Visio, etc.
  • Experience with networking features and protocols such as: ARP, CDP, EIGRP, OSPF, BGP, VTP, EtherChannel, 802.1Q trunking, HSRP, QoS, multicast, IPsec, RADIUS/TACACS+, SNMP, BRI/PRI, MPLS
  • Experience working with SDWAN
  • Experience working with network topology related to Cloud
  • Familiarity and experience working with cloud networking
